Where are Firefox cache files stored?

If you haven’t changed the install location of Firefox cache, then you’ll be able to find all the present Firefox browser cache files by following the below paths: For Windows 10/8: C:\Users\{user}\AppData\Local\Mozilla\Firefox\Profiles\{profile folder}\cache2.

Why does Firefox save files to temp?

Hi Timothy, it’s normal for Firefox to use the Windows Temp folder for downloads. If you choose Save, Firefox moves the file to your chosen folder. At least, it should move the file. If Firefox is not moving downloaded files, there could be a problem with permissions on the system.

Where are my temporary Internet files?

By default, temporary Internet files are stored in %SystemDrive%\Users\%Username%\AppData\Local\Microsoft\Windows\Temporary Internet Files\. This location may be changed by selecting Move folder… and selecting in the pop up Windows Explorer window where the files should be stored.

How do I move my temp folder?

Select the TEMP variable and then click the “Edit” button. In the Edit User Variable window, type a new path for the TEMP folder into the “Variable value” box. Alternatively, you can click the “Browse Directory” button to browse to your desired location.

Why does my download go to temp?

If the file stays in the temp folder then it is possible that your security software is blocking the file and prevents Firefox from moving the file to the specified destination folder and rename the file to the correct file name and extension.
